Peggy Sharp returns with her annual ALL NEW audio program, sharing the best NEW children’s books, all of which have been recently published.  In this unique program, Peggy guides you through the most outstanding titles and shares highly practical, ready-to-use-tomorrow ideas for incorporating the books into all areas of your curriculum.

Included: four CDs and comprehensive resource handbook

You will learn how to:

  • make new fiction and nonfiction titles an integral part of your literacy program
  • share new books in ways that will encourage children to read for themselves
  • incorporate the latest tech tie-ins so readers can connect their computer knowledge with their reading
  • motivate even your most reluctant readers with winning book selections and engaging instructional strategies
  • use trendy, popular books as a way to move students into higher quality reading material
  • tap the magic of picture books at every elementary grade level
